Why Coastal Air Accelerates Rust on Metal Fencing
Living near the coast means constant exposure to airborne salt particles. Even if you cannot see it, salt settles on metal surfaces and speeds up oxidation.
Key contributing factors include:
- Salt spray carried inland by wind
- Fine salt particles clinging to fence panels & posts
- Chemical reactions between salt & exposed metal
- Increased moisture retention on surfaces
When salt accumulates, it breaks down protective coatings and allows corrosion to begin beneath the surface. Over time, this can weaken structural components. High Humidity & Monsoon Seasons: A Perfect Storm for Corrosion
Coastal climates bring more than just salt. High humidity and heavy rainfall create extended periods of moisture exposure, particularly during the wet season.
Environmental conditions that contribute to rust include:
- Persistent moisture sitting on metal surfaces
- Limited drying time between rain events
- Water pooling around fence posts
- Organic debris trapping dampness
Moisture is a primary ingredient in rust formation. When fences remain damp for prolonged periods, oxidation accelerates. Regular inspections after the wet season help identify early signs of corrosion. Addressing small areas of surface rust early can prevent more significant structural deterioration.
The Role of Fence Material Selection in Long-Term Durability
Material choice plays a decisive role in how well a fence performs in coastal environments. Not all metals respond the same way to salt, moisture and constant humidity. Some materials naturally resist corrosion, while others rely heavily on protective coatings. Selecting the right option can significantly influence durability, maintenance needs and overall lifespan.
Common options include:
- Galvanised steel with protective zinc coating
- Aluminium, which naturally resists rust
- Powder-coated finishes for added surface protection
- Treated steel designed for coastal exposure
Selecting appropriate materials can significantly influence lifespan. Aluminium fencing, for example, does not rust in the same way steel does. Galvanised and coated products provide additional protection when properly maintained. Poor Installation Practices Can Speed Up Rust Development
Even durable materials can deteriorate prematurely if installation methods are flawed. Proper drainage, spacing and protection are critical.
Installation factors that affect corrosion include:
- Posts set without adequate drainage
- Insufficient ground clearance
- Damaged protective coatings during installation
- Low-quality fasteners prone to corrosion
Water pooling around fence bases creates prolonged moisture exposure, accelerating rust at ground level. Secure fixings and correct post-treatment reduce risk. How Minor Surface Damage Turns into Major Corrosion
Small scratches and chips may seem cosmetic, but they expose bare metal to the elements. In coastal environments, that exposure quickly becomes problematic.
Surface damage may result from:
- Impact from lawn equipment
- Storm debris
- General wear over time
- Improper cleaning methods
Once protective coatings are compromised, moisture and salt begin attacking the exposed area. Rust spreads beneath paint layers and along joints. Prompt touch-ups and repairs help stop corrosion from expanding. Regular visual checks allow property owners to respond early before damage becomes structural.
Preventative Maintenance That Slows Rust in Coastal Areas
While coastal exposure cannot be eliminated, maintenance can significantly slow the corrosion process. Simple preventative measures make a measurable difference.
Effective maintenance includes:
- Washing down metal fencing to remove salt build-up
- Inspecting joints, fasteners & base plates
- Reapplying protective coatings when required
- Clearing debris that traps moisture

When Fence Repairs Are Enough & Replacement Makes Sense
Not all rust damage requires full replacement. In many cases, targeted repairs restore strength and appearance.
Repairs may be suitable when:
- Rust is confined to isolated areas
- Structural posts remain sound
- Protective coatings can be reapplied
- Damage has not compromised stability
Replacement becomes necessary when corrosion spreads extensively or structural components weaken. A detailed inspection provides clarity on whether repair or replacement offers better long-term value. Making the right decision early prevents ongoing maintenance costs from escalating unnecessarily.
